Exploring the Diverse Job Market in McKinney
McKinney, Texas, a vibrant city north of Dallas, boasts a dynamic and growing economy. This economic vitality translates into a broad spectrum of part-time job openings across various industries. From retail and hospitality to healthcare and administrative support, there are ample opportunities for individuals seeking flexible employment.
Retail and Customer Service Roles
The retail sector is a significant employer in McKinney, offering numerous part-time positions. Stores in the historic downtown square, as well as larger shopping centers like the Stonebridge Town Center, frequently seek sales associates, cashiers, stockers, and customer service representatives. These roles often provide flexible scheduling, making them ideal for students or those balancing other commitments.
In our experience, retail positions are an excellent entry point for individuals new to the workforce. They provide foundational skills in customer interaction, sales techniques, and inventory management. Many retailers also offer employee discounts and opportunities for advancement.
Hospitality and Food Service
McKinney's burgeoning culinary scene and numerous hotels create a consistent demand for part-time staff in the hospitality industry. Restaurants, cafes, bars, and event venues often hire servers, hosts, bartenders, kitchen staff, and event assistants. These jobs can be fast-paced and require excellent interpersonal skills.
We've found that working in food service teaches valuable lessons in teamwork, problem-solving under pressure, and time management. The tips and service charges associated with many roles can also significantly boost earning potential.
Healthcare Support Positions
The healthcare industry in McKinney is expanding, with several clinics, hospitals, and long-term care facilities. While many roles require specific certifications, there are often entry-level part-time positions available. These can include roles like medical receptionists, administrative assistants in medical offices, patient transporters, or support staff in labs.
For those interested in a career in healthcare, these positions offer invaluable exposure to a professional medical environment. They provide a firsthand understanding of patient care and healthcare operations, often serving as a stepping stone to further education or certification.
Administrative and Office Support
Businesses of all sizes in McKinney require administrative support, creating a steady stream of part-time office jobs. These roles may involve answering phones, scheduling appointments, managing correspondence, data entry, and general office upkeep. Strategies for Finding Part-Time Jobs in McKinney
Securing a part-time job requires a proactive and strategic approach. Here are some effective methods to help you find suitable employment in McKinney:
Utilize Online Job Boards
Major online job boards are essential tools for any job seeker. Websites like Indeed, LinkedIn, Glassdoor, and Simply Hired allow you to filter searches by location (McKinney, TX), job type (part-time), and industry. Leverage Local Resources
Don't overlook local resources. The McKinney Chamber of Commerce website often lists job openings from member businesses. Local community centers and libraries may also have job boards or offer career services. Networking within the community can uncover hidden opportunities.
Network with Professionals
Informational interviews and networking events can be highly beneficial. Reach out to professionals working in industries that interest you in McKinney. Let them know you are seeking part-time work. Often, opportunities arise through personal connections before they are publicly advertised.
Visit Businesses Directly
For retail and food service positions, sometimes the best approach is to visit businesses directly during non-peak hours. Inquire about openings and leave your resume. A personal interaction can make a positive impression.
Tips for a Successful Job Application
Once you've identified potential opportunities, presenting yourself effectively is key to landing the job.
Tailor Your Resume and Cover Letter
Customize your resume and cover letter for each specific job application. Highlight the skills and experiences most relevant to the position's requirements. Use keywords from the job description to pass through applicant tracking systems (ATS).
Prepare for Interviews
Research the company thoroughly before your interview. Understand their mission, values, and recent activities. Prepare answers to common interview questions, focusing on your skills, experience, and why you are a good fit for a part-time role. Be ready to discuss your availability clearly.
Emphasize Reliability and Availability
For part-time roles, employers highly value reliability and clear availability. Be upfront about the hours you can commit to and demonstrate your willingness to be punctual and dependable. This is crucial for a smooth workflow for the employer.

Q2: Are there many remote part-time jobs available in McKinney?
A2: While the number of remote part-time jobs is growing, many positions in McKinney are on-site due to the nature of retail, service, and healthcare industries. However, administrative and customer support roles may offer remote flexibility.
Q3: How can I find entry-level part-time jobs in McKinney?
A3: Entry-level positions are abundant in retail and food service. Online job boards, local business websites, and even visiting stores directly can help you find these opportunities. Look for titles like "Sales Associate," "Cashier," "Server," or "Host."
Q4: What qualifications do I need for a part-time job in McKinney?
A4: Requirements vary greatly. Many entry-level jobs require only a high school diploma or equivalent and good communication skills. Some roles, particularly in healthcare or specialized fields, may require specific certifications or prior experience.
Q5: Can students easily find part-time jobs in McKinney?
A5: Yes, students can find numerous part-time jobs in McKinney. Retail, food service, and administrative support roles often offer flexible hours suitable for student schedules. Local universities and high schools can also be good resources for job postings.
